AI Summary
-
Delays implementation of new rates for family residential services and life sharing services from January 1, 2026 to January 1, 2029 (or upon federal approval, whichever is later) by amending multiple sections of Laws 2023, chapter 61
-
Establishes the Advisory Task Force on Family Residential Services to evaluate proposed rate modifications and their impact on existing family residential services and licensed adult family foster care providers
-
Task force membership includes 10 members: four licensed adult family foster care providers, two Department of Human Services representatives, one lead agency representative, one ARRM representative, and two service recipients, with appointments due by January 1, 2026
-
Requires the task force to submit a report by August 1, 2027 with recommendations on payment rate methodologies for family residential and life sharing services, and a second report by January 15, 2030 assessing implementation impacts
-
Appropriates unspecified amounts from the general fund for fiscal years 2026-2029 to support the task force, which expires June 30, 2030
